Not sure what you mean by "bad". It's a simple frame grabber, which means you
have to do compression in software, which with Myth limits you to only a
couple of codecs, that are not the best.
But it works, I have a 3000 I use with XAWTV on a non-Myth machine, it
certainly does what it's supposed to do, it's nice to be able to get analog
and digital using only one slot.
